The Fiberglass Duct Wrap Insulation market is primarily segmented by product types and applications. In terms of product types, it is divided into Fiberglass Duct Wrap Insulation With Facings and Without Facings. The versions with facings offer additional moisture resistance and enhanced vapor control, making them crucial for specific applications. Conversely, those without facings provide a simpler, cost-effective solution where moisture control is not a concern. On the application side, the market is categorized into Commercial and Residential sectors. Commercial applications account for a significant market share due to growing construction and renovation projects, while the Residential sector is increasingly adopting fiberglass duct wrap due to rising energy efficiency standards and awareness. The Fiberglass Duct Wrap Insulation market is characterized by a competitive landscape dominated by established key players including Knauf Insulation, Owens Corning, Manson Insulation, Johns Manville, and CMI Specialty Insulation. Owens Corning and Johns Manville hold substantial market shares, driven by their broad product portfolios and strong distribution networks. These companies focus on innovation and sustainability, investing in advanced manufacturing techniques and eco-friendly materials to meet growing energy efficiency regulations. Meanwhile, emerging challengers such as CMI Specialty Insulation are making notable strides by specializing in niche applications, leveraging superior customer service, and offering flexible product solutions that appeal to specific market segments. A significant recent development in the industry is the increasing emphasis on environmentally sustainable products, as the demand for low-VOC (volatile organic compound) insulation solutions rises. This trend is reshaping product offerings across the board. According to market estimates, Owens Corning holds approximately 25% of the market share, followed closely by Johns Manville at around 22%, while Knauf Insulation trails slightly with about 18%.
